CHLORAKAS - CONCERN ABOUT THE €3.6m DUE TO GOVERNMENT BUDGET DELAY

 Filenews 31 December 2020 - by Dora Christodoulou



The call for tenders for the construction of five parallel break breakers and for the construction of a boat-launch ramp in the "Alytzi" area of Chloraka may have been launched from 23 November, but the local authority and other local bodies have been waiting and appear concerned about the smooth promotion of procedures.

The reason for this development is, of course, the negative developments at the level of the functioning of the State due to the non-voting of the State Budget.

Chloraka now expects the procedures for its adoption to be carried out, albeit late, in order for the projects inclusion in it for the coming year to be properly promoted. According to our information, the authorities of Chloraka are mainly concerned with the aspect of the timetable set for the submission of tenders for the major project. The last date was 15 January, with several sides considering that the delays around the adoption of the De facto Budget will also alter this timetable.

The project was launched by the Department of Public Works. The estimated cost of the project is EUR 3.6 million plus VAT.
